Judicature
The judicial power of El Salvador is exercised by the Supreme Court, the Procurator-General's Office, etc. The Supreme Court is composed of 15 judges (including the President) and is elected by Parliament. The President of the Supreme Court shall serve for a term of five years and shall be eligible for re-election. Judges are appointed for a term of nine years, with 1/3 re-elected every three years. The Attorney General shall be elected by Parliament for a term of three years and shall be eligible for re-election. El Salvador's coffee accounts for 40% of the country's exports, and it is usually picked in November, December and January-March of the following year. The export of raw beans lasts almost all year round. Coffee is produced in seven of the country's 14 provinces, with the largest number in the northwestern provinces of chalatenango and santa ana. El Salvador produces 100% Arabica coffee, 68% of which is bourbon, which usually grows at an altitude of 1062 Mel 1972 meters. On the other hand, El Salvador has a unique mountain, river and plateau, which provides a suitable environment for the growth of bourbon coffee. At the same time, El Salvador's suitable temperature, abundant precipitation and fertile soil are also indispensable natural conditions for breeding high-quality coffee beans. Like other typical island beans, Salvadoran coffee is balanced, soft and good in texture.
Features of Salvadoran coffee:
Coffee from El Salvador is a specialty of Central America, where it is light, fragrant, pure and slightly sour.
Flavor: balanced taste and good texture
Recommended baking method: moderate to deep, with a variety of uses

Market for Salvadoran coffee:
The best Salvadoran coffee is exported from January to March, and 35% of the extra hard beans are exported to Germany.
In 1990, the government of El Salvador privatized part of the coffee export industry, hoping to increase the income rate of coffee in the export market.
